Factors to Consider When Choosing an Espresso Machine for Coffee Shop

espresso machine selection criteria

When you’re choosing an espresso machine for your coffee shop, it’s important to think about how many drinks it’ll need to handle during those busy peak hours. You want something that can keep up without slowing down.

Also, consider how consistent the brewing is and how easy it is to maintain the machine — these factors really affect your daily workflow. Oh, and don’t forget to check if the machine comes with a built-in grinder; that can save you some counter space and time.

Finally, make sure the espresso machine matches your shop’s power and voltage setup. This way, you avoid any electrical headaches down the line.

Machine Capacity Needs

Although choosing the right espresso machine depends on various factors, you’ll want to start by considering your shop’s daily coffee volume. This helps confirm the machine meets peak demand without sacrificing quality. Look for machines with multiple group heads so you can brew several shots simultaneously. This is essential during busy periods.

Prioritize models with larger boiler capacities, such as 5.5 liters or dual boilers. These help maintain consistent temperature and pressure for ideal extraction. High-pressure rotary pumps and programmable settings make handling high-volume output more efficient.

Also, make sure you have enough counter space since commercial machines tend to be larger. They may need professional installation for plumbing and electrical connections too. Matching machine capacity with your shop’s demand guarantees smooth service and satisfied customers.

Brewing Consistency Factors

Matching your espresso machine’s capacity to your shop’s demand sets the stage, but maintaining brewing consistency keeps customers coming back.

To achieve this, look for machines that maintain around 9 bars of pressure during extraction. This ensures ideal espresso quality. Programmable settings let you fine-tune temperature and extraction time, so every shot tastes just right.

Stability in brewing temperature is essential. Advanced PID technology helps prevent fluctuations that could spoil the flavor or crema. Low-pressure pre-infusion features also play a role by evenly saturating grounds before full pressure, avoiding uneven extraction.

While grinder quality matters, focus here on how your machine’s precise control over pressure and temperature guarantees consistent, delicious espresso shot after shot. That’s how you build trust with every cup you serve.

Maintenance and Cleaning

Integrating a grinder into your espresso machine boosts flavor and efficiency, but keeping that machine in excellent shape requires regular maintenance and cleaning. You should routinely clean group heads, portafilters, and steam wands to prevent coffee oil buildup that can compromise taste and hygiene.

Choose machines with removable parts like water reservoirs and drip trays to simplify this process. Some models offer self-cleaning functions that save you time while maintaining consistent cleanliness. Don’t forget to descale periodically, especially if you’re in a hard water area, to avoid mineral deposits that can damage internal components.

Also, clean and calibrate the grinder regularly to guarantee a consistent grind size, which is key to brewing high-quality espresso every time. Proper upkeep extends your machine’s life and ensures exceptional coffee. So, taking a little time for maintenance really pays off in the long run!

Power and Voltage Requirements

Choosing the right espresso machine for your coffee shop means paying close attention to power and voltage requirements. Most commercial machines need a higher voltage, typically 220V, to support high-volume brewing and consistent performance. You’ll want to check your shop’s electrical system to guarantee compatibility.

Installing these machines often requires professional work and possibly a dedicated circuit for safety and efficiency. Pay attention to wattage, too. Higher wattage means faster heat-up times and better steam pressure for milk frothing.

Machines with high-pressure rotary vane pumps especially demand a robust electrical supply to maintain consistent pressure. Confirming your machine’s power needs match your infrastructure helps avoid operational hiccups and keeps your coffee flowing smoothly throughout the day.

Durability and Materials

A coffee shop’s espresso machine needs to withstand constant use, so durability is key. You should look for machines made from stainless steel and copper, as these materials resist corrosion and wear over time. Heavy-duty construction is essential in busy environments, guaranteeing the machine handles frequent use without performance drops.

Focus on models with high-quality components like rotary vane pumps and robust boilers that maintain consistent pressure and temperature. Commercial machines often feature thicker casings and reinforced parts to survive daily rigors. Don’t forget the importance of regular maintenance and easy part replacement, which can notably extend your machine’s lifespan.

Prioritizing durability and materials guarantees your investment lasts and keeps your coffee shop running smoothly. It’s really about choosing the right build that can handle the hustle and bustle every day. That way, you avoid downtime and keep serving great coffee without a hitch.

How Energy-Efficient Are Commercial Espresso Machines?

Commercial espresso machines can be quite energy-efficient, especially newer models designed with energy-saving features. You’ll find machines with programmable timers, sleep modes, and insulated boilers that reduce power consumption when not in active use.

What Maintenance Schedule Is Ideal for Espresso Machines?

Think of your espresso machine like a trusty steed that needs daily care to keep galloping. You should clean group heads and steam wands after every use. Backflush weekly with detergent, and descale monthly to prevent mineral buildup.

Checking seals and gaskets quarterly guarantees no leaks sneak in. Sticking to this maintenance schedule keeps your machine running smoothly and your coffee tasting legendary. It’s just like a knight ready for battle every day.

Can Espresso Machines Accommodate Alternative Milk Options?

Yes, many espresso machines can accommodate alternative milk options. You can easily steam oat, almond, soy, or coconut milk using the machine’s steam wand, just like regular dairy milk. Some machines even have adjustable steam pressure to better froth these plant-based milks, which often require different techniques.

Just make sure to clean the steam wand thoroughly after each use to prevent residue buildup from alternative milks. This will help keep your machine in top shape.
